One of the biggest questions we get from business owners who are just starting to consider podcast guesting is: “What’s the ROI?”

In this episode, we break down the different ways that you can see a return on investment from being a podcast guest and why the value goes far beyond immediate sales.

What You’ll Learn in This Episode

Direct ROI: New Clients & Sales

The most straightforward return is closing clients who discover you on a show. It happens more often than you’d think—but it’s only the beginning.

SEO & Backlink Benefits

Every interview often comes with a link to your website or social media. These backlinks strengthen your site authority and help improve your search rankings long-term.

Instant Thought Leadership Content

Each interview becomes repurposable content you can share across your platforms—positioning you as the trusted expert your audience needs.

Expanded Brand Awareness

Showing up on multiple podcasts allows more people to get to know who you are and what you do. When someone asks their network for a solution you offer, you’re the one they recommend.

High-Value Relationships With Hosts

Hosts are well-connected and often introduce our clients to referral partners, JV collaborators, and speaking opportunities.

Speaking Engagement Opportunities

Many podcast hosts run events, mastermind groups, or conferences. Guesting puts you on their radar for future invitations.

Sharpen Your Message

Each interview is a rep—but with a live audience. You’ll quickly learn what messaging resonates and what falls flat.

Traffic to Your Website & Socials

Listeners who connect with you take action. Podcast appearances reliably drive warm traffic to your online platforms.

A Reality Check on Your Offer

If you’re getting exposure to thousands of listeners and dozens of hosts—but no one is reaching out—this is priceless data. It’s a sign to look at your offer, messaging, or audience fit.

Opportunity to Address Common Objections

Hosts often ask the same questions your leads ask—and your answers can remove objections before prospects even get on a call.

Educate Your Audience at Scale

Every interview teaches listeners who you are, what you do, and why it matters—building familiarity and trust before they ever speak to you.
